Transaction 72e6670bb15be6861d878d8c5eb1fc26a2a83e83472540fdb5c8f4fc203bd6ec
1 Input
1 Output
-
72e6670bb15be6861d878d8c5eb1fc26a2a83e83472540fdb5c8f4fc203bd6ec:0
- value
- 6442286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10cf6babef07af3952d0d91107c5de444397d063 OP_EQUAL
- address
- 33DuDSxpxJHjSmeWBJTprX2fVMtaDhQcMG